Understanding Slug and Snail Behaviour

Slugs and snails are notorious for their destructive feeding habits, but understanding their behavior is crucial for effective control. They are primarily nocturnal creatures, meaning they are most active during the night or on cloudy days. This makes direct observation difficult but also suggests that preventative measures focused on creating barriers or disrupting their movement during these times can be particularly effective. Different species exhibit slightly different preferences regarding the types of plants they target, but generally, young seedlings, tender leaves, and decaying vegetation are most appealing. They navigate using a combination of chemical trails and environmental cues, meaning slug populations can build up in areas where food is readily available and conditions are favorable. Knowing these details is paramount in crafting a successful defense against their presence.

The Role of Moisture and Habitat

Moisture plays a vital role in slug and snail activity, as they require a damp environment to survive. Gardens with high humidity, poor drainage, or frequent rainfall tend to attract larger populations. Reducing moisture levels through improved ventilation, strategic watering techniques, and removing excessive ground cover can help create a less hospitable environment. Similarly, providing shelter for natural predators, such as hedgehogs, frogs, and birds, can contribute to a natural form of pest control. These creatures actively feed on slugs and snails, helping to keep their numbers in check. Creating a balanced ecosystem is always beneficial, and encouraging biodiversity is a key part of that process.

Preventative Measures for a Healthy Garden

Proactive prevention is often the most effective approach to managing slugs and snails. This involves creating a garden environment that is less attractive to these pests and implementing barriers to protect vulnerable plants. Regularly clearing away debris, removing weeds, and ensuring good air circulation can all help reduce moisture levels and eliminate hiding places. Proper garden hygiene is paramount, as slugs and snails will readily congregate in areas with decaying organic matter. Consider raised beds or container gardening, as these can make it more difficult for slugs to reach plants. Utilizing companion planting, with varieties known to deter slugs and snails, can also be a valuable preventative strategy.

Companion Planting Strategies

Certain plants are known to repel slugs and snails, or at least make them less likely to target nearby crops. Allium species, such as garlic and onions, are commonly used as companion plants due to their strong scent, which is believed to disrupt slug trails. Similarly, herbs like rosemary and thyme can act as natural deterrents. Marigolds and nasturtiums are also thought to repel slugs, while also attracting beneficial insects. When planning a garden layout, consider incorporating these companion plants around vulnerable species to provide an added layer of protection. Strategic placement and thoughtful combinations can significantly reduce the risk of slug damage.

Effective Control Methods – A Detailed Look

While prevention is ideal, sometimes direct control measures are necessary. There are numerous options available, ranging from organic solutions to chemical treatments. Organic pellets containing iron phosphate are a popular choice, as they are considered safe for pets and wildlife while effectively killing slugs and snails. Beer traps, while somewhat messy, can be effective in attracting and drowning these pests. Manual collection, although time-consuming, is a reliable method for removing slugs and snails from smaller gardens. Nematodes, microscopic worms that parasitize slugs, are another biological control option that can be highly effective when applied correctly. When choosing a control method, carefully consider the potential impact on the environment and beneficial organisms.

Understanding the Risks of Chemical Control

While chemical slug and snail pellets can provide rapid results, they also pose risks to the environment and non-target species. Metaldehyde-based pellets, in particular, are highly toxic to pets, wildlife, and even humans if ingested. Their use is increasingly discouraged due to these concerns. Even seemingly harmless options may have unintended consequences, such as disrupting the soil ecosystem or harming beneficial insects. Therefore, it's crucial to explore and prioritize organic and biological control methods whenever possible. A sustainable gardening approach focuses on minimizing the use of harmful chemicals and fostering a healthy, balanced ecosystem.

The Importance of Soil Health

Often overlooked, the health of your soil plays a crucial role in plant resilience and resistance to pests and diseases, including those caused by slugs and snails. Healthy soil provides plants with the nutrients they need to thrive, making them less susceptible to damage. Improving soil structure through the addition of organic matter, such as compost and well-rotted manure, enhances drainage and aeration, creating a less favorable environment for slugs and snails. A balanced soil microbiome also contributes to plant health and can help suppress pest populations. Regularly testing your soil’s pH and nutrient levels can help you identify any deficiencies and address them accordingly. Investing in soil health is an investment in the long-term health of your garden.

Adapting Strategies for Different Plant Types

Different plants exhibit varying degrees of susceptibility to slug and snail damage, and the most effective control strategies may need to be adjusted accordingly. Young seedlings are particularly vulnerable and require extra protection, such as cloches or horticultural fleece. Hostas, known for being a favorite food source for slugs, may necessitate more intensive control measures. Conversely, plants with tough, leathery leaves or aromatic foliage are naturally more resistant. Understanding the specific needs of your plants and tailoring your approach accordingly will maximize your chances of success.
